Ágnes Gulyás is a scholar working on Environmental Engineering, Health, Toxicology and Mutagenesis and Global and Planetary Change. According to data from OpenAlex, Ágnes Gulyás has authored 48 papers receiving a total of 976 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Environmental Engineering, 13 papers in Health, Toxicology and Mutagenesis and 12 papers in Global and Planetary Change. Recurrent topics in Ágnes Gulyás’s work include Urban Heat Island Mitigation (19 papers), Urban Green Space and Health (10 papers) and Land Use and Ecosystem Services (7 papers). Ágnes Gulyás is often cited by papers focused on Urban Heat Island Mitigation (19 papers), Urban Green Space and Health (10 papers) and Land Use and Ecosystem Services (7 papers). Ágnes Gulyás collaborates with scholars based in Hungary, United Kingdom and Austria. Ágnes Gulyás's co-authors include János Unger, Andreas Matzarakis, Noémi Kántor, Márton Kiss, Eszter Tanács, Zoltán Sümeghy, Angela Hof, László Mucsi, Csilla Gál and Tamás Gál and has published in prestigious journals such as Building and Environment, Sustainability and Ecological Indicators.
